KEG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2013 in Review

174 of the 3,085 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KEY ENERGY SERVICES INC (KEG) for Q3 2013, worth a combined $1.05B — up 27% from $826M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 26 funds closed out of KEG and 25 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 59 trimmed existing stakes and 65 added.

The largest buyer was SAC Capital Advisors, adding an estimated $27.5M. The largest seller was Starboard Value, exiting entirely with an estimated $13.4M sold.
